Qualified Secondary Teacher | Hounslow

A welcoming and inclusive secondary school in Hounslow is seeking a dedicated and Qualified Secondary Teacher to join their team on a short-term basis. Contract lengths may vary depending on the needs of the school, making this an excellent opportunity for teachers who enjoy the flexibility of contract work while gaining experience in a supportive and well-established school environment.

The successful candidate will hold Qualified Teacher Status (QTS) and be confident teaching across a range of secondary subjects when required. As a Qualified Secondary Teacher, you will be adaptable, proactive, and capable of delivering engaging lessons that inspire students to achieve their full potential. Whether covering planned absences or supporting the school during busy periods, you will play a key role in maintaining high standards of teaching and learning.

Qualified Secondary Teacher - Key Responsibilities:

  • Plan and deliver engaging, high-quality lessons where required.
  • Teach across a variety of secondary subjects and year groups, adapting to the needs of the school.
  • Create a positive, inclusive, and safe learning environment for all students.
  • Manage classroom behaviour effectively in line with school policies.
  • Assess student progress and provide constructive feedback where appropriate.
  • Work collaboratively with colleagues and contribute positively to the wider school community.

Qualified Secondary Teacher - Requirements:

  • Qualified Teacher Status (QTS).
  • Previous experience teaching in UK secondary schools.
  • Flexibility and confidence teaching different subjects when needed.
  • Strong classroom management and communication skills.
  • A positive, professional, and adaptable approach to teaching.
  • An enhanced DBS registered on the Update Service, or willingness to obtain one.
